Technical Context
The W25Q128FVFJP TR implements a flexible SPI-compatible command set with volatile/non-volatile status registers controlling block protection (BP2–BP0), top/bottom lock (TB), security register locks (LB3–LB1), and quad enable (QE). Its architecture supports simultaneous read-while-write via Erase/Program Suspend/Resume functionality.
It delivers true execute-in-place (XIP) capability using Continuous Read Mode with ≤8-clock instruction overhead and wrap lengths of 8/16/32/64 bytes. QPI mode reduces instruction overhead by encoding commands and addresses in 4-bit nibbles per clock cycle, enabling 416MHz effective throughput with 104MHz CLK.

Pinout & Package
W25Q128FVFJP TR uses an 8-pin SOIC-208mil package (Package Code S), with pin 1 = /CS, pin 2 = DO (IO1), pin 3 = /WP (IO2), pin 4 = GND, pin 5 = DI (IO0), pin 6 = CLK, pin 7 = /HOLD or /RESET (IO3), pin 8 = VCC. Pin 7 functions as /HOLD in standard/dual SPI mode; when QE=1, it becomes IO3 for quad operations.

FAQ
What is the package type and pin count of the W25Q128FVFJP TR?
The W25Q128FVFJP TR uses an 8-pin SOIC-208mil package (Package Code S), with standardized pinout including /CS, DO/IO1, /WP/IO2, GND, DI/IO0, CLK, /HOLD or /RESET/IO3, and VCC. This footprint is industry-standard and compatible with automated SMT assembly lines and legacy board layouts designed for similar serial flash devices.
Does the W25Q128FVFJP TR support execute-in-place (XIP) operation?
Yes, the W25Q128FVFJP TR supports true XIP via Continuous Read Mode with wrap lengths of 8/16/32/64 bytes and ≤8-clock instruction overhead. When paired with a QPI-capable host controller, it enables deterministic code fetch directly from flash without copying to RAM - reducing boot time and SRAM usage in Cortex-M and RISC-V microcontrollers.
How does hardware write protection work on the W25Q128FVFJP TR?
Hardware write protection on the W25Q128FVFJP TR is implemented via the active-low /WP pin, which - when asserted - prevents writes to the status register. It works in conjunction with non-volatile block protect bits (BP2–BP0), top/bottom lock (TB), and complement protect (CMP) to safeguard sectors as small as 4KB. Note that /WP is disabled when Quad Enable (QE) is set, as pin 3 becomes IO2.
What is the purpose of the /HOLD pin on the W25Q128FVFJP TR?
The /HOLD pin on the W25Q128FVFJP TR allows pausing ongoing SPI transactions while /CS remains low - placing DO in high-impedance state and ignoring DI/CLK edges. This enables bus sharing among multiple SPI slaves without requiring full deselect/reselect cycles. Like /WP, /HOLD is unavailable in Quad SPI mode (pin 7 becomes IO3 when QE=1).
